Cheap Bus tickets to Waubaushene

What are the most popular routes to Waubaushene?

Toronto - WaubausheneAverage price$31Average duration2hDaily departures2
Barrie - WaubausheneAverage price$19Average duration25mDaily departures2
Sudbury - WaubausheneAverage price$32Average duration2h 50mDaily departures1
Kingston - WaubausheneAverage price$101Average duration8h 50mDaily departures1
Ottawa - WaubausheneAverage price$109Average duration11h 35mDaily departures5